This is one of the most frightening as well as compelling programs I have ever seen. Imagine 50 men in 3 days arranging to meet a minor at home alone over the Internet and then actually showing up. Instead of meeting the young girl or boy they targeted, the host of Dateline, Chris Hanson walks in. As they leave the police are there waiting for them. Youll see people from all walks of life including a Rabbi, several teachers and even a homeland security official!

I felt the same way. I was so glad that Chris Hansen didn't even try to interview the guy, just sent him out and got the kid out of there. In the last one, which took place in Ft.Myers, they had a guy that rode on a bus for 4 hours just to meet a 12 year old girl!With all the stress that the media puts on looking at your local predator lists, I think this makes it clear that we really can't know who is targeting our children, the best we can do is teach them how to react if they were ever in danger.
